How to Get to Mount Everest Base Camp?
Many people ask: How to get to Mount Everest Base Camp?
Fly to Kathmandu, Nepal’s capital.
From Kathmandu, take a short domestic flight to Lukla — the gateway to the Everest region.
From Lukla, the real Everest Base Camp trek begins! The journey takes you through Phakding, Namche Bazaar, Tengboche, Dingboche, Lobuche, and Gorakshep before finally reaching the Everest Base Camp (EBC).
The trail is well-established and filled with guesthouses, known as “teahouses,” where trekkers can eat, rest, and stay overnight.
Understanding the Everest Base Camp Trek Map
Before beginning your trek, it’s important to study the Everest Base Camp trek map. The map gives a clear idea of the terrain, altitudes, and daily milestones.
The standard route from Lukla to Everest Base Camp covers approximately 130 kilometers round trip, with gradual elevation. The Mount Everest Base Camp trek distance from Lukla to EBC is around 65 kilometers one way, taking about 12 to 14 days including acclimatization stops.
Using a map helps trekkers plan their journey, manage their pace, and prepare for altitude adjustments.
Mount Everest Base Camp Trek Distance and Elevation
Understanding the MountEverest Base Camp trek distance and altitude change is crucial for safe and successful trekking.
Starting Point (Lukla): 2,860 meters
Namche Bazaar: 3,440 meters
Everest Base Camp: 5,364 meters
The gradual increase in altitude helps with acclimatization and reduces the risk of altitude sickness. Fitness preparation before the trip is recommended.
